About

Beijing Government Scholarship for International Students (Beijing Foreign Student Scholarship) is launched by the Government of Beijing and the scheme supports part of the tuition fee for outstanding current and future international students  in Beijing universities.

Benefits

Beijing Government Scholarship - First Class (BGS1)

  • Students with this scholarship pay only CNY5,000/year as tuition
  • This Scholarship category DOES NOT include monthly allowance, Comprehensive medical insurance, and accommodation

Beijing Government Scholarship -Second Class (BGS2)

Students with this scholarship pay half the tuition:

  • Bachelor: CNY 13000/year
  • Master: CNY 15000/year
  • Doctor: CNY 18000/year

This Scholarship category DOES NOT include monthly allowance, Comprehensive medical insurance, and accommodation

Eligibility

1. The applicant must be a non-Chinese citizen, be healthy, law abiding and have no criminal  record. The applicant meet the basic requirements for admission in our school for international students to study in China;

2. Language level requirements:

    English-taught majors:

   (1) Applicants for undergraduate programs need to provide IELTS 6.0, TOEFL 75 or above, or proof of language proficiency at the corresponding level. Applicants with strong Chinese proficiency are preferred.

   (2) Applicants for graduate programs need to provide IELTS 6.5, TOEFL 80 or above, or provide proof of language proficiency at the appropriate level. Strong Chinese proficiency is an advantage;

   Execptions:Applicants from countries whose official language is English and want to apply for English-taught majors do not need to provide proof of English proficiency。

    Chinese-taught majors:

    (1) Undergraduate programs require applicants to have a Chinese proficiency of 222 or above at HSK-4 level.

    (2) The postgraduate programs require applicants to have Chinese proficiency at HSK-5 level or above.

3. The requirements for applicants’ degree and age are that applicants must:

  •   be a high school graduate under the age of 25 when applying for the undergraduate programs.
  •   be a bachelor’s degree holder under the age of 35 when applying for the master’s programs.
  •   be a master’s degree holder under the age of 45 when applying for the doctoral programs.

Application deadlines:

Undergraduate degree: June 15;

Master's and Ph.D degree: May 30

1. Scanned copies of all China visa pages and China entry and exit record pages, passport photos with white background, photo size 480x720

2. The highest academic certificate and transcript, with an average score of more than 70% (non-Chinese or English materials need to provide certified Chinese/English translations)

3. Certificate of Language Proficiency

4. Study and research plan

5. Foreigner Physical Examination Form (Health Certificate) (Laboratory report must be attached)

6. Certificate of no criminal record

7. Two recommendation letters (associate professor or above) (required for postgraduate program applications)

8. Acceptance letter from supervisor (It is recommended that applicants for master's programs have a letter of acceptance from supervisors , applicants for Ph.D programs must have a letter of acceptance from supervisors)
